>but yeah IPs dont work like textbooks or CDs so I dont see why they would sell it as a package deal.
I mean, it's happened before
When Disney bought the Fox Kids brand from Saban they also got their IPs like Power Rangers, VR Troopers, etc
Disney had.....zero idea on what to do with Power Rangers and sold everything back to Saban eventually
Saban would go on to try (and fail miserably) to recreate his success in the 90's only for the 2017 movie to flop leading to Hasbro buying Power Rangers (and literally everything else Saban owned) for 52 million
They had plans ONLY for Power Rangers (until the guy whose idea was to buy the IP literally got cancer and died which led to Hasbro being confused on what to even do with the IP) but still had to buy VR Troopers, Beetleborgs, My Pet Monster, etc as part of the deal even if all those other less popular, "unnecessary" IPs were just in the way and likely just inflated the total cost to acquire the one IP they did want
Bare in mind, Haim's an infamous greedy bastard so he could just an exception to the rule when it comes to these cases
When Square Enix were open to selling Eidos for cheap they let Embracer pick and choose what they wanted (Deus Ex, Thief, Tomb Raider, Legacy of Kain, and some soccer management simulation but not Gex which Square Enix still owns)
